Use better null-handling around registrar certificates (#922)
* Use better null-handling around registrar certificates Now with Optional it's always very clear whether they do or do not have values. isNullOrEmpty() shouldn't be necessary anymore (indeed it wasn't necessary prior to this either, as the relevant setters in the Registrar builder already coerced empty strings to null). And also the cert hash is a required HTTP header, so it will error out in the Dagger component if null or empty long before getting to any other code. * Merge branch 'master' into optional-get-certs
